About Leona
I hold a Master’s degree in Electronics and have over nine years of experience teaching and mentoring aspiring engineers. My philosophy is simple: understanding comes from doing. In my classroom, students don’t just study circuits—they build them, simulate them, and test their behaviour. I encourage inquiry, creativity, and disciplined reasoning, helping each learner develop the mindset of an engineer. I keep lessons dynamic by integrating real-world examples, emerging technologies, and problem-solving case studies. Whether explaining signal modulation or power systems, I aim to make engineering both exciting and deeply logical. My mission is to help students see Electrical Engineering as more than technical mastery—it’s the art of bringing innovation to life through science and design.

My Electrical Engineering lessons combine conceptual precision with applied learning. Students begin with circuit theory, electromagnetism, and digital logic before exploring system analysis, power electronics, and signal processing. Each topic is linked to real engineering challenges. I emphasise visualisation through simulations and schematic analysis, ensuring that abstract current flow and field theory become intuitively clear. Lessons often include virtual labs and project-based exercises that mirror professional problem-solving. Through guided reasoning, learners develop both analytical and design-thinking skills. We explore how engineering principles apply to innovations like electric vehicles, robotics, and smart grids. By the end of my course, students can design, troubleshoot, and optimise electrical systems confidently, ready for both exams and practical application.
